The Framework: Four Hidden Costs That Kill Your Budget

My initial approach to buying a UV laser cutter was completely wrong. I thought the machine with the lowest price tag was the best choice. Two budget overruns later, I learned to look beyond the sticker. Here's the framework I now use:

  1. Consumables & Wear Parts: An electronic adhesive mixer might seem cheap, but if its mixing blades need replacing every 6 months, that's a recurring cost the initial quote hides.
  2. Training & Downtime: A complex CO2 laser marking machine with poor documentation can cost you 40 hours of lost productivity while your team figures it out.
  3. Calibration & Maintenance: Precision equipment like laboratory mixing equipment requires regular calibration. Vendor A includes 2 years of calibration in the price; Vendor B charges per visit.
  4. Rush Fees & Expedites: When a critical part for your centrifugal planetary mixer fails, you don't have time to shop around. You pay whatever the vendor asks.

Why does this matter? Because I've seen companies save $2,000 on a machine only to lose $4,000 in downtime and expedite fees within the first year.

Real Example: The UV Laser Cutter That Cost Us $6,500 More

In Q2 2024, we needed a UV laser precision cutter for a new production line. We got quotes from three vendors:

  • Vendor A: $18,500 (includes 2-year warranty, 1 year of calibration, and 3-day on-site training)
  • Vendor B: $16,200 (1-year warranty, calibration not included, basic online training)
  • Vendor C: $14,800 (1-year warranty, no calibration or training included)

I almost went with Vendor C. But then I calculated the TCO: calibration visits at $800 each, training materials at $300, and potential downtime from lack of support. Over 3 years, Vendor C's TCO was $19,200—$6,500 more than Vendor A's $18,500. The difference was hidden in the fine print.

The Case of the 'Cheap' Centrifugal Planetary Mixer

A colleague at another firm bought a budget centrifugal planetary mixer for their lab. The price was great—about 30% less than the industry standard. But within 8 months, the drive belt failed. The replacement part cost $450, but the real hit was the 2 weeks of lost production time. Their TCO analysis, which they hadn't done, would have shown the 'cheap' option costing nearly double over 3 years.

The question isn't whether you can afford the premium equipment. It's whether you can afford the hidden costs of the budget option.

When the Budget Option Makes Sense

I'll be honest: I'm not saying you always need the most expensive option. For a low-usage lab that runs a CO2 laser marking machine once a week, a basic model with minimal support might be perfectly fine. But for production environments where uptime equals revenue, investing in a higher-quality electronic component laser cutting system with strong support is almost always the better financial decision.

I built a simple cost calculator after getting burned on hidden fees twice. It includes: base price, expected consumables cost over 3 years, estimated maintenance visits, training cost, and a 10% buffer for unexpected downtime. I make sure every quote I get passes through that spreadsheet before I sign anything.

One more thing: vendor relationships matter. When we had an emergency with our laboratory mixing equipment, our regular vendor had a technician on-site within 24 hours. That kind of service is priceless—and it doesn't show up on any initial quote.
